A New Dimension in Particle Analysis
For over 50 years Microtrac has been at the forefront of particle characterization of materials using Laser Diffraction technology. Laser Diffraction has become the de-facto standard for measuring particle size distributions as it is fast, accurate and provides data for material over a wide particle size range (0.01 to 4000 microns). Microtrac SYNC expands that capability by incorporating Dynamic Image Analysis which allows a synchronous measurement of both Laser Diffraction and Image Analysis data on the same sample in the same sample cell at the same time. With the SYNC, as well as getting general Particle Size Distributions, the user can access data on shape parameters like sphericity, aspect ratio and many other morphological parameters.

- Outlier detection. Laser diffraction alone cannot always detect small numbers of particles outside the main distribution that may have an effect on the quality of end products. Because Image Analysis allows us to look at individual particles, the SYNC can detect outliers even down to single particles.
